Men's Soccer Notches Fourth Double-OT Draw; Ties Rhode Island College 1-1
Providence, RI. - The Clark University mens soccer team notched their fourth double-overtime tie of the season with a 1-1 draw against Rhode Island College in non-conference action on Wednesday evening.
The Anchormen concluded a four-game home stand with a 2-0-2 mark as they are now 5-3-2 on the season. Clark, which played to its fourth tie in the last six contests, is now 2-2-4 overall marking the most ties since the 1986-87 campaign (13-3-4).
The Cougars got on the board in the 35th minute as sophomore midfielder Tom Ashley (Boulder, CO) broke down the right wing and fired a shot across the box, which deflected off RIC senior defender James Nigrelli (Ashaway,RI) and into the net for an own-goal.
The Anchormen evened the game up, 1-1, in the 52nd minute as freshman defender Joe Sousa (Cumberland, RI) fired a free kick from 30 yards out that was redirected by sophomore midfielder Ryan Kelley (Hope, RI) for his team-leading sixth goal of the season. It was Sousa¹s first career assist and point.
RIC had several quality chances to win the game as junior midfielder Brandon Migliore (Coventry, RI) and senior forward Derek Rocha (Fall River,MA) hit the crossbar and post, respectivel,y in the second half and overtime.
RIC outshot its opponent, 25-13 in the game, but both teams were even in corner kicks with six apiece.
Senior goalkeeper Jadon Neves (Warren, RI) made five saves for RIC. Clark junior goalkeeper Peter Wise (Providence, RI) made seven stops - six in the second half - to move to 2-2-4.
Clark will return to NEWMAC action on Saturday against cross-town rival WPI at 1:30 p.m. at Granger Field. Rhode Island College will play at Little East Conference rival Western Connecticut on Saturday, Sept. 29 at 6 p.m.
